There is interest in freezing ovarian tissue and then a later stage, we're implanting it. For a woman who goes through menopause, say 51 biologically, what we would consider a natural menopause,. I think there are a lot of factors that need to be considered in terms of extending the lifespan of that person's ovarian function. If we give estrogen back as hormone replacement therapy, we're not giving it back to levels that you would see in a 20-year-old. We give back very small amounts.
